MONTHLY WHOLESALE TRADE: SALES AND INVENTORIES

June 2008

Sales. The U.S. Census Bureau announced today that June 2008 sales of merchant wholesalers, except manufacturers’ sales branches and offices,

after adjustment for seasonal variations and trading-day differences but not for price changes, were $411.2 billion, up 2.8 percent (+/-0.5%) from the

revised May level and were up 17.0 percent (+/-1.0%) from the June 2007 level. The May preliminary estimate was revised upward $2.4 billion or

0.6 percent. June sales of durable goods were up 1.3 percent (+/-0.8%) from last month and were up 9.0 percent (+/-1.7%) from a year ago.

Compared to last month, sales of computer and computer peripheral equipment and software were up 3.4 percent and sales of lumber and other

construction materials were up 1.9 percent. Sales of nondurable goods were up 4.1 percent (+/-0.8%) from last month and were up 24.3 percent

(+/-1.7%) from last year. Sales of petroleum and petroleum products were up 12.7 percent from last month and sales of chemcials and allied products

were up 5.3 percent.

Inventories. Total inventories of merchant wholesalers, except manufacturers’ sales branches and offices, after adjustment for seasonal variations

but not for price changes, were $435.9 billion at the end of June, up 1.1 percent (+/-0.3%) from the revised May level and were up 9.5 percent

(+/-1.2%) from a year ago. The May preliminary estimate was revised upward $0.3 billion or 0.1 percent. End-of-month inventories of durable goods

were up 0.6 percent (+/-0.5%) from last month and were up 6.2 percent (+/-1.2%) from last June. Inventories of metals and minerals, except

petroleum were up 4.2 percent. End-of-month inventories of nondurable goods increased 1.8 percent (+/-0.7%) from May and were up 15.1 percent

(+/-2.0%) compared to last June. Inventories of petroleum and petroleum products were up 8.3 percent from last month and inventories of farm

products raw materials were up 7.1 percent.

Inventories/Sales Ratio. The June inventories/sales ratio for merchant wholesalers, except manufacturers’ sales branches and offices, based on

seasonally adjusted data, was 1.06. The June 2007 ratio was 1.13.
